Goldendoodles are among some of the country’s most-popular designer Doodle breeds. Bred from a Golden Retriever and a Poodle, this breed is best known for its outgoing temperament, colorful, low-shedding coats, and intelligence. Like many designer Doodle breeds, they come in several sizes.

Suppose you’re interested in getting a Goldendoodle and live in Indiana. In that case, you’ll need to reach out to a reputable breeder to ensure the puppy you get isn’t from a puppy mill. Responsible breeders prioritize each puppy’s health above profits for this popular breed and answer all your questions.
